Using a ball, roller, and this myofascial release tutorial with Ashley will … WebFull Calf Release Start by placing your ball on the floor. Position your lower leg so that the ball is placed directly above your Achilles tendon. Place your left foot on the floor to help you roll forward and back on the ball. Slide your body …
